About Sr Product Manager II

  Disney Streaming Data team is seeking a Senior Data Product Manager who will be an exceptional addition to our growing data product management team. In this role, you will deliver data products and solutions for the Subscriber vertical of Disney Streaming. The ideal candidate is an experienced data product manager, capable of building products from ideas and with a proven track record of managing multi-year product roadmaps. This candidate builds fantastic relationships across all levels of the organizations and is recognized as a problem solver that looks to elevate the work of everyone around them. If you are passionate about data and creating products and capabilities to democratize data across the organization, then this is a great role for you.

  Define the vision, strategy, and roadmap for data products and capabilities aligned to organizational and business goals.

  Build relationships with key technology and business teams to ensure success.

  Partner with Analytics, Data Science, Data Engineering, Data Architecture, Data Quality & Governance, Product Design, and other Technical Program Management team members to develop, test, and deliver high quality products and features.

  Ensure the data product development life cycle (PDLC) efficiently delivers valuable solutions to our customers’ business needs and continually adapts to the needs of the organization.

  Manage daily incoming data product improvement requests from internal customers and prioritize using on BRICE model.

  Collect and analyze qualitative and quantitative data to enable the product and engineering organization to make insightful product decisions.

  Organize and present data product and operations metrics to key stakeholders to communicate progress towards business drivers.

  Anticipate project risks and issues, confidently address any and all challenges, mitigate risks and issues and escalate to appropriate parties where required.

  Lead and drive teams on all business readiness activities, including product planning, sequencing, testing, user education, rollout, iteration, and support.

  Develop detailed product requirements, user stories, acceptance criteria, and success measures.

  Ability to identify risks, resolve key blockers, and establish appropriate resolution paths.

  Ability to fill in gaps across roles and functions as needed, performing as an adaptive problem solver.

  Ability to champion a collaborative work environment that cultivates shared understanding, transparency, autonomy, innovation, and continuous learning.

  WHAT TO BRING

  Minimum 7+ years in product management experience with building and delivering successful data products, services and capabilities. Or a combination of minimum 1+ years in product management and 3+ years in engineering, analytics, data science or related fields.

  Undergraduate Degree in Engineering, Math, Science, Economics, or equivalent.

  Planning acumen and proven ability to break down work and define an MVP, as well as subsequent iterations

  Highly analytical and collaborative qualities with strong technical, strategic and problem-solving skills

  Understanding of and ability to decipher/write SQL code, and basic coding in Python, LookML, etc.

  Experience and comfort solving problems in an ambiguous environment where there is constant change. Have the tenacity to thrive in a dynamic and fast-paced environment, inspire change, and collaborate with a variety of individuals and organizational partners

  Experience utilizing both qualitative analysis and quantitative analysis techniques and familiarity with common data science models and approaches to problem-solving. Generally: the ability to plan for what analysts and data scientists need to deliver.

  Experience demonstrating leadership, self-motivation, accountability, and a standout colleague.

  Managing large scale implementation of data sets including - data ingestion, integration and reporting tools experience.

  Understanding of the Data science workflow, the terminology and the unique challenges associated with the domain

  NICE-TO-HAVES

  Advance CS degree or MBA is a plus

  Knowledge and experience with subscription lifecycle

  Shown experience in video streaming and OTT

  Experience with ThoughtSpot, Tableau, Looker or other visualization tools

  Experience with large scale enterprise applications using big data solutions such as Hadoop, HBase, Spark, Kafka, Airflow, AWS Glue, etc.

  Experience or knowledge of basic programming and DB's technologies (SQL, Python, Cassandra, MongoDB, Redis, Couchbase, Oracle, MySQL, Teradata)

  The hiring range for this position in Santa Monica and Connecticut is $149,240 to $ 200,200 per year and in Seattle and New York City is $156,292 to $ 209,660 per year and in San Francisco is $163,426 to $ 219,230 per year. The base pay actually offered will take into account internal equity and also may vary depending on the candidate’s geographic region,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ience among other factors. A bonus and/or long-term incentive units may be provided as part of the compensation package, in addition to the full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its, dependent on the level and position offered.
